Shipments of unbranded sundries to Saudi Arabia via dedicated Middle East sea freight lines are not guaranteed detention, yet they carry a relatively high risk of customs inspection. Saudi Customs enforces rigorous clearance standards and mandatory SABER certification. Unbranded miscellaneous goods are categorized as routine inspection targets due to simplified documentation and non-standard packaging. Many shippers mistakenly believe goods without logos are risk-free while overlooking local clearance provisions, which is the primary cause of frequent detentions for unbranded cargo.
There are four leading reasons for cargo seizure:
1.Improper customs declaration. Under-declared value, vague commodity descriptions, and failure to mark goods as unbranded will easily trigger manual inspections.
2.Non-compliant packaging. Packages without bilingual Arabic-English labels will be deemed three-no products (no brand, no manufacturer, no origin).
3.Missing mandatory certifications. Cosmetics, electronics and other regulated items lack compulsory SABER and SASO approvals.
4.Implied intellectual property infringement. Merchandise with designs visually similar to registered trademarks will be ruled infringing even without printed logos.

To mitigate risks, opt for official dedicated Middle East sea freight lines with local in-house clearance teams that pre-review documents and eliminate hidden hazards to cut inspection probabilities. Shippers must also implement full compliance measures: declare cargo values truthfully and clearly label goods as unbranded, attach compliant origin markings on outer cartons, avoid counterfeit-like patterns, and prepare relevant certifications plus neutral product declarations for cosmetics, electronics and other regulated categories.
In summary, risks for shipping unbranded sundries to Saudi Arabia are manageable. Detention and return risks can be avoided by strictly regulating declaration, packaging and certification requirements, in partnership with a reliable sea freight forwarder.
